从并行处理的角度描述了属于粗粒度或中粒度的二种并行结构,将其应用于先进的10MW高温气冷堆核电站I&C仪表控制系统中。所谓粗粒度并行结构是指分布于全厂、基于全局数据库概念的令牌总线型ARCNET高速数据干线计算机网络系统。中粒度并行结构是指上述计算机网络的某些节点是基于局部存储共享的多处理机系统。它们均是松散耦合多处理机系统,文中介绍了二种结构在反应堆I&C系统和保护系统中的应用。
